BRATTLEBORO — The Boys & Girls Club of Brattleboro's afterschool program at Retreat Farm has advanced to Level-5 in the state-wide STARS Program.

STARS (STep Ahead Recognition System) is Vermont’s quality recognition and improvement system for child care, preschool, and afterschool programs. Participation in STARS means a program strives beyond licensing regulations to meet higher quality standards, uphold professional practices, and commit to continuous quality improvement.

Due to the diligence and determination of multiple staff members, The Club increased its STARS rating from 3 to 5 (the highest rating available), according to a news release.
